Tranfer update at Pustertal, Linz and Ljubljana

The HC Pustertal signed Anthony Bardaro of the HCB Südtirol Alperia, for whom the 28-years-old played the last two seasons. In 112 appearances, the center scored 77 points (38G / 39A). The Steinbach Black Wings 1992 extended with Brian Lebler  for three more seasons . The 32-year-old forward thus faces seasons ten, eleven and twelve in Linz. HK SZ Olimpija Ljubljana signed forward Guillaume Leclerc. The 25-year-old Frenchman wasthe top scorer in the strongest French league in the 2018/2019 season with Grenoble. Last season, the right winger played for Amiens in France and Rødovre in Denmark.

Luciano Basile, head coach of the HC Pustertal is happy about the new signing: "Bardaro is versatile and at the best age. He is team-serving and individually strong at the same time. I have met an intelligent person, with his heart in the right place. That's why I'm sure Anthony will be a very important part of our project."

Anthony Bardaro, who will receive the number 18 at the HCP: "I am proud to be a part of this project. Already as an opponent I soaked up the atmosphere in the Rienzstadion and imagined how it would be to play here. My national team friends have only good things to say about the club, the fans and the city. After two exciting years in Bolzano, I'm looking forward to the adventure with the Wolves and my wife and I are already waiting impatiently for the new season!"

Brianl Lebler signs three more years in Linz

In the championship year 2011/12, the Steinbach Black Wings brought Brian Lebler to Linz in 1992. In the meantime, the Canadian-Austrian dual national has already completed nine seasons for the Black Wings. His commitment to Linz was only interrupted in the 2015/16 season by a brief stint with ERC Ingolstadt. In seven of his nine seasons with the Black Wings so far, Brian Lebler scored more than 30 goals.

French striker for Ljubljana
The 25-year-old Frenchman Guillaume Leclerc gained experience in his professional career so far with Grenoble and Amiens (France), Poprad (Slovakia(, Bietigheim (Germany) and Rodovre (Denmark). In the 2018/2019 season, the goal-scorer was the top scorer in the strongest French league.
